Honeywell APT4000 Series Toroidal Conductivity Transmitters Overview The Honeywell Analytical Process Transmitter APT 4000 Series transmitter continuously measures conductivity chemical concentration and salinity in industrial processes within the chemical food and dairy pulp and paper refinery metals and other industries The APT4000 s NEMA 4X IP65 rated enclosure is specifically designed to meet the measurement needs of Class I Division 2 non incendive and general purpose areas The transmitter can be used with Honeywell toroidal conductivity cells or electrically compatible sensors The transmitter has a universal 20 253 V ac dc 45 65 Hz power supply with one 4 20 mA output two high low alarm relays a diagnostic relay and a wash relay Honeywell CAL CONF APT4000 TC Description The Honeywell APT4000 series of transmitters offers the widest available selection of advanced features in a reliable and economical instrument Quick Problem Assessment The APT4000 has a large front display for quick recognition of process parameters and diagnostics even at a distance Only the APT4000 employs visual feedback to quicken setup and maintenance times and to minimize errors made during calibrations Visual feedback refers to pictograph type characters that appear on the display both to prompt and respond to operator and process changes Reliability First The advanced features of the AP

T4000 transmitter guarantee complete reliability The APT4000 continuously monitors sensor and transmitter electronics and immediately displays diagnostic information at the onset of a problem If an error or diagnostic is found the transmitter will indicate the appropriate error code or pictograph see Figure 2 blink a red LED and adjust the error current to 22 mA if desired A manual loop back check is available to test the integrity of the 4 20 mA output Pictograph type characters also appear during problem conditions to report diagnostics for easy trouble shooting There is even a Sensoface pictograph that provides constant MEAS CAL oo WASH CONF 70 82 03 42 3 01 Page 1 of 8 Specification gt APPROVED ENTER Figure 1 APT4000 TC Transmitter feedback to the operator on whether or not there is a problem with the cell These easily learned and recognized symbols make the APT4000 an easy to use instrument in any language Foolproof Calibrations Each Honeywell conductivity cell has unique measuring characteristics when shipped from the factory It is possible that these characteristics will vary slightly depending upon the installation as well For optimum accuracy a single point calibration in a known conductivity solution should be performed when a new cell is installed Further calibration adjustments are also available for enhanced accuracy in special applications Sensing and Control
